A 37 (2004) 5605-5624 %D 2004 %T Semiclassical analysis of constrained quantum systems %A Gianfausto Dell'Antonio %A Lucattilio Tenuta %X We study the dynamics of a quantum particle in R^(n+m) constrained by a strong potential force to stay within a distance of order hbar (in suitable units) from a smooth n-dimensional submanifold M. We prove that in the semiclassical limit the evolution of the wave function is approximated in norm, up to terms of order hbar^(1/2), by the evolution of a semiclassical wave packet centred on the trajectory of the corresponding classical constrained system. %B J.
